Admission Procedures
1. Application for Admission
In order to apply for admission into Putra Intelek International College, please complete the Registration Form (Including Part F to H) and submit with the following documents:
-
A certified copy of evidence of your English language proficiency (if applicable)
-
1 photocopy of main pages (details/picture) of passport
-
Certified copies of your high school/higher learning institutions attached (to provide certified translation if it is in another language)
-
4 passport size photographs
-
Health examination report has been endorsed by a registered physician
-
Initial payment of USD 1000 as Application Fee, Student Visa, Registration Fee and Medical Insurance, to be made payable to 'Intellect-Ed Sdn. Bhd.' by bank draft.
-
No Objection Certificate (NOC) (for students from Sub Sahara Africa only; endorsed by the Ministry of Education in your country)
-
No Objection Certificate (NOC) (for students who use entry qualification from Sub-Sahara countries)
Upon receiving the receipt and required information, and also after verifying payment has been credited into the College’s bank account, the College will send to you an official receipt for the payment received.
2. Admission Letter
Once the Application Form has been received with complete documentation and payment, the letter of offer and payment receipt will be issued and sent to you within 4 weeks.
Applicants are required to meet the College's minimum level of entry.

Visa & Immigration
Student Pass
-
All international students are required to apply for a Student Pass to study in Malaysia. It will usually take at least 2 months to obtain approval for a Student Pass. Hence, you are advised to submit your application 2 ½ months prior to the commencement date of each intake.
-
Upon submission of the completed Application Form with the relevant documents and payment stipulated in the Admission section, Putra Intelek International College will proceed to apply for your Student Pass from Malaysia.
Letter from Malaysian Immigration
Upon approval of the Student Pass, Putra Intelek will send you an approval letter from the Malaysian Immigration Department. For immigration clearance, you will need to produce this approval letter upon arrival at the airport.
Visa Requirement (if applicable)
If the regulations in your country require you to obtain an Entry Visa before leaving the country, you will have to make such application at the nearest Malaysian Embassy/Consulate Office. Otherwise, you may proceed to Malaysia without a visa. However, a visa will be issued to you after you arrive in Malaysia.
Journey Performed Visa
If you arrive in Malaysia before the student pass is approved, you may have to pay RM500 to the Malaysian Immigrations Department as processing fee for a Journey Performed Visa. If you are in this circumstance, i.e. your student pass has yet to be approved, and then you are REQUIRED to enter Malaysia with a return air ticket. Without the return air ticket, you will not be allowed to enter Malaysia.
